Softball Splits Little East Opener Against Panthers
DARTMOUTH, Mass. – Backed by an extra innings hit from junior outfielder Olivia Ali, the UMass Dartmouth softball team posted a doubleheader split against Plymouth State University on Saturday in the Little East opener for both teams. The Corsairs are now 10-4 overall after winning game one, 3-2 in eight innings, while the Panthers move to 6-10 on the season with a 5-3 game two victory.
